Mexico City, July 6 (IANS) Jude Bellingham scored a brace and Harry Kane converted a penalty as England overcame co-hosts Mexico in a thrilling, incident-packed last-16 contest to set up a FIFA World Cup 2026 quarter-final showdown with Norway. England are in the last eight in three consecutive editions for the second time, after 1962 (quarter-final), 1966 (winners), and 1970 (quarter-final). New Jersey, June 28 (IANS) Harry Kane’s record-breaking goal after Jude Bellingham’s opener helped England to a 2-0 win over Panama at the FIFA World Cup 2026 to secure their position at the top of Group L. Panama frustrated England in the first half. It was Bellingham who provided the key, holding off his marker and prodding in on the volley from Bukayo Saka’s corner after 62 minutes.
